Questions about Knox

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    As a Bull Terrier, Knox does well in homes where he can spend plenty of time with his people and get daily exercise. Apartments work if he's properly exercised, but a house with a secure yard is ideal.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Knox, as a Bull Terrier, benefits from access to a yard or frequent outdoor activities. He needs space to burn off his high energy and curiosity.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Knox's breed, the Bull Terrier, is often known for being playful and resilient, making him suitable for families with children when properly supervised and introduced.
